Now that all the would - be candidates from the Senate majority have decided to take a pass on the race, it appears support is coalescing behind Assemblywoman Jane Corwin, who has the support of Langworthy, (who I believe controls the lion's share of
the weighted vote in the district) former Rep. Tom Reynolds, who held the seat before Lee, and others.
Hoping to avoid a repeat of the NY - 23 nightmare (at least it was from a GOP perspective), Erie County Conservative Chairman Ralph Lorigo, who controls the largest share of
the weighted vote in the district, told me that he's inclined to support Corwin, too, but needs to wait and see what his committee members say when they meet tonight.

Under the
weighted voting system employed by major parties, committee members are rewarded for turning out the
vote in their
districts in gubernatorial elections.
